No Iron Man 4 According to Robert Downey Jr.

If you’ve familiarized yourself with Marvel Studios’ plans for the next four years, this shouldn’t come as a huge surprise though now it appears semi-official. Though he will appear in Avengers: Age of Ultron and most likely Avengers 3, Iron Man won’t be getting a fourth installment any time soon. Robert Downey Jr. confirmed this in an interview with Variety:

There isn’t one in the pipe. No, there’s no plan for a fourth ‘Iron Man.’

Marvel Studios’ next films will include Avengers: Age of Ultron (2015), Ant Man (2015), Captain America 3 (2016) and Guardians of the Galaxy 2 (2017). Doctor Strange and Thor 3 should have release dates soon as well. With so many films currently in the pipeline, it’s so crowded that an Iron Man sequel just doesn’t seem in the works for the near future. It’s all part of a push to focus on more new characters according to Kevin Feige.

I don’t know that we’ll keep to [that model] every year, but what we’re doing this year [in 2014] and what we’re doing next year is: existing franchise, new franchise, existing franchise, new franchise. So I think it would be fun to continue that sort of thing. I don’t know that we will [do that] all the time, but as a general model, I think that would be fun.

At this rate it appears that a future Iron Man movie will be very far out and that RDJ will most likely be replaced by a new actor. What did Downey think about that?

I like that the idea is that it would be up to me, like I’m casting director for Marvel.
